Have you ever wondered what LaMDA is all about? LaMDA, which stands for “Language Model for Dialogue Applications,” is an impressive breakthrough in natural language processing technology. This revolutionary AI model developed by Google can hold dynamic and engaging conversations, making it capable of understanding context, nuances, and even following up on previous topics. LaMDA has the potential to significantly enhance the way we interact with AI systems, opening doors to more conversational and natural dialogue experiences. Let’s dive into the fascinating realm of LaMDA and discover its incredible possibilities.
What is LaMDA?
LaMDA (Language Model for Dialogue Applications) is a revolutionary natural language processing model developed by Google. It aims to enhance conversational AI systems by improving their ability to engage in more natural and dynamic conversations with users. LaMDA has garnered significant attention in the AI community for its potential to revolutionize how we interact with machines and enable more human-like conversations.
1. Introduction to LaMDA
1.1 Understanding the basics
At its core, LaMDA is a language model that can interpret and generate human-like responses in a conversation. This means that it can understand the context and nuances of a conversation and provide meaningful and coherent responses. Unlike traditional language models that generate responses based on pre-defined templates, LaMDA can generate responses organically, allowing for more dynamic and engaging interactions.
1.2 Motivation behind LaMDA
The motivation behind LaMDA stems from the need to improve the conversational abilities of AI systems. Traditional chatbots and virtual assistants often struggle to understand and respond appropriately to complex queries or ambiguous language. LaMDA aims to address this limitation by training on a diverse range of conversations, enabling it to grasp the context and nuances of human conversation better. The goal is to make AI systems more conversational and capable of providing accurate and contextually appropriate responses.
2. How Does LaMDA Work?
2.1 Language modeling
LaMDA relies on a sophisticated language modeling technique to understand and generate responses. It is trained on a vast corpus of text data, allowing it to learn patterns and relationships between words and phrases. This training equips LaMDA with the knowledge of grammar, syntax, and vocabulary necessary to generate coherent and contextually appropriate responses.
2.2 Transformer architecture
Underneath LaMDA’s language modeling capabilities lies the transformer architecture. This architecture forms the backbone of LaMDA’s ability to process and analyze complex language patterns efficiently. By leveraging attention mechanisms and self-attention layers, the transformer architecture enables LaMDA to capture and analyze the dependencies between different words and phrases in a conversation. This allows for more accurate understanding and generation of responses.
2.3 Bidirectional capability
LaMDA also boasts a unique bidirectional capability that sets it apart from other language models. This bidirectional approach enables LaMDA to understand the context of a conversation by considering both the previous dialogue and the subsequent dialogue. This bidirectional understanding allows LaMDA to generate more contextually appropriate responses, fostering more natural and engaging conversations.
3. Advancements in Natural Language Processing
3.1 Challenges in NLP
Natural Language Processing (NLP) has long faced challenges in understanding and generating human-like language. Contextual understanding, ambiguity, and maintaining coherence are some of the major hurdles. LaMDA aims to address these challenges by training on extensive conversational data, allowing it to grasp the intricacies of real-world conversations better.
3.2 Benefits of LaMDA
LaMDA brings several benefits to the field of NLP. By improving contextual understanding, it enables more natural and dynamic conversations between humans and AI systems. LaMDA also tends to generate more accurate and coherent responses, reducing instances of misunderstanding or confusion. Moreover, its bidirectional capability allows it to consider both past and future context, enhancing its ability to understand and generate responses accurately.
4. Applications of LaMDA
4.1 Conversational AI
One of the key applications of LaMDA is in the field of conversational AI. LaMDA’s ability to engage in dynamic and contextually appropriate conversations makes it an ideal candidate for powering virtual assistants, chatbots, and other conversational agents. It allows these systems to better understand user queries and generate more relevant and accurate responses, improving user experience and satisfaction.
4.2 Translation and Interpretation
LaMDA’s language modeling capabilities can also be leveraged in translation and interpretation tasks. By understanding context and nuance, LaMDA can overcome challenges faced by traditional translation models. It can handle ambiguous language, idiomatic expressions, and cultural nuances, resulting in more accurate and contextually appropriate translations and interpretations.
4.3 Chatbots and Virtual Assistants
Chatbots and virtual assistants powered by LaMDA can greatly benefit various industries. From customer service to healthcare, these AI-powered agents can assist users in finding information, answering questions, and even providing emotional support. LaMDA’s human-like conversation abilities ensure that users feel engaged and understood, improving overall satisfaction and user experience.
5. Implications and Ethical Considerations
5.1 Potential biases and discrimination
As with any AI technology, there are concerns about potential biases and discrimination when deploying LaMDA. The language model learns from the vast amount of text data available on the internet, which may contain biases reflected in society. Efforts must be made to ensure that LaMDA is trained on diverse and inclusive data to mitigate these biases and promote fairness.
5.2 Data privacy concerns
The nature of LaMDA’s language processing requires the use of massive amounts of data, which raises concerns about data privacy. Ensuring the privacy and security of user conversations becomes vital to maintain trust. Developers need to implement robust data handling practices and obtain user consent to protect sensitive information shared during conversations.
6. Future of LaMDA
6.1 Impact on user experience
The future of LaMDA holds tremendous potential in transforming user experience with AI systems. With its more human-like conversation abilities, LaMDA can make interactions with AI-powered applications feel more natural and intuitive. This enhanced user experience can pave the way for increased adoption and trust in conversational AI technologies.
6.2 Enhanced human-computer interaction
LaMDA’s bidirectional capability and improved contextual understanding have broader implications for human-computer interaction. It opens up possibilities for more complex and seamless interactions with machines. Users can expect AI systems that provide meaningful explanations, engage in in-depth discussions, and adapt to their preferences and needs more effectively.
7. Alternatives to LaMDA
7.1 GPT-3 and GPT-4
LaMDA is not the only advanced language model in the field. OpenAI’s GPT-3 and future iterations like GPT-4 offer similar capabilities, such as generating human-like text and understanding context. These models also contribute to enhancing conversational AI systems and pushing the boundaries of what is possible in natural language processing.
Another notable alternative to LaMDA is BERT (Bidirectional Encoder Representations from Transformers). BERT focuses on understanding the contextual meaning of words and phrases, making it suitable for applications like sentiment analysis, question answering, and text classification. While BERT and LaMDA share some similarities, they have distinct focuses and applications within the broader field of NLP.
7.3 Other language models
There are numerous other language models and architectures in the field of NLP, each with its own unique strengths and applications. From T5 to XLNet, researchers are continuously pushing the boundaries of language understanding and generation. These alternatives contribute to the development of a diverse ecosystem of NLP models and advance the capabilities of AI systems.
8. Current Limitations of LaMDA
8.1 Training requirements
Training a language model as advanced as LaMDA requires immense computational resources and vast amounts of data. Fine-tuning and optimizing the model to achieve the desired performance can be time-consuming and resource-intensive. These training requirements pose challenges for scalability and accessibility, limiting the broader adoption of LaMDA.
8.2 Computational resources
Alongside training requirements, deploying LaMDA in real-world applications demands significant computational resources to ensure smooth and efficient conversation processing. Application developers and organizations need to consider the infrastructure necessary to handle the computational demands of LaMDA, which may be a barrier for smaller enterprises with limited resources.
8.3 Dataset biases
Like other language models, LaMDA’s training data can introduce biases that exist within the text corpus used for training. However, Google has committed to addressing biases and ensuring fairness in its models. Continual efforts to diversify training data and minimize biases are essential to prevent perpetuation of societal biases and discriminatory behavior.
LaMDA represents a significant advancement in the field of natural language processing, particularly in the context of conversational AI. Its language modeling, transformer architecture, and bidirectional capabilities enable more natural and engaging conversations between humans and AI systems. Although it comes with potential challenges, such as biases and training requirements, LaMDA’s future prospects appear promising. As developers refine and optimize the model, LaMDA has the potential to reshape the way we interact with AI, enhancing user experiences and advancing human-computer interaction.